Ingredients You’ll Need

The beauty of Classic Chicken Salad lies in its simplicity and the way each component elevates the others. Every ingredient serves its own purpose, whether adding texture, flavor, or creaminess—so don’t be tempted to skip the essentials!

  • Cooked chicken (4 cups, shredded or diced): The star of the show, use leftover rotisserie or freshly poached chicken for the best texture and flavor.
  • Mayonnaise (1 cup): A creamy base holds it all together—use good-quality mayo for that rich, classic taste.
  • Celery (½ cup, diced): Brings crispness and a pop of fresh, green flavor—finely dice to make sure every bite has crunch.
  • Red onion or shallots (⅓ cup, diced tiny): Adds color and a gentle sharpness, making sure the salad never feels dull.
  • Green onions or chives (2 tablespoons, sliced): These bring a mild bite and a touch of herby brightness.
  • Dijon mustard (1 tablespoon): For a subtle tang and depth that keeps the Classic Chicken Salad from being flat.
  • Lemon juice (2 teaspoons): Brightens all the flavors and prevents the salad from feeling too heavy.
  • Kosher salt (½ teaspoon): Essential for bringing all the flavors into balance—taste and adjust if you like.
  • Black pepper (¼ teaspoon): A pinch of pepper grounds the salad and lends gentle warmth.

How to Make Classic Chicken Salad

Step 1: Gather and Prep Ingredients

First things first—get all your ingredients measured out and ready to go. Dice the celery and red onion or shallots finely, slice those green onions or chives, and shred or cube your cooked chicken. Having everything prepped makes mixing a breeze and ensures the Classic Chicken Salad comes together smoothly.

Step 2: Mix the Salad Base

In a large mixing bowl, combine the shredded or chopped chicken, diced celery, red onion, and green onions. Give them a gentle toss to distribute the vegetables evenly among the chicken. This step ensures that every forkful of Classic Chicken Salad gets a bit of everything.

Step 3: Add the Dressings and Flavors

Spoon in the m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, kosher salt, and black pepper. Using a spatula or wooden spoon, fold the mixture together until everything is well coated with that luscious dressing. Be sure to mix gently so the chicken holds its texture and the salad stays light and fluffy.

Step 4: Taste and Adjust

Once the salad is fully mixed, give it a quick taste. This is where you can adjust the salt and pepper, or even add a little more lemon juice if you prefer a brighter flavor. Don’t be afraid to personalize your Classic Chicken Salad at this stage—sometimes an extra pinch of salt or another squeeze of lemon is all it takes.

Step 5: Chill or Serve

You can serve your Classic Chicken Salad right away, but letting it chill in the fridge for at least 30 minutes really allows the flavors to meld. Cover the bowl or spoon the salad into a lidded container, then refrigerate until you’re ready to dish it up.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Leftover Classic Chicken Salad is best transferred to an airtight container and kept refrigerated. It stays fresh and delicious for up to 3 days—just remember to give it a gentle stir before serving, as some separation can occur as it chills.

Freezing

Technically, you can freeze Classic Chicken Salad, but the dressing may separate and the texture of the vegetables can suffer once thawed. If you need to freeze it, consider freezing the chicken mixture alone, then combining with mayo, veggies, and seasonings fresh when ready to serve.

Reheating

Classic Chicken Salad is meant to be enjoyed cold or at room temperature, so reheating isn’t necessary. If you’ve just taken it from the fridge, let it sit out for a few minutes to take the chill off before serving for best flavor and consistency.

FAQs

What type of chicken works best for Classic Chicken Salad?

Both shredded and diced cooked chicken are wonderful—you can use rotisserie chicken for convenience or poach boneless breasts or thighs for a homemade touch. Try to avoid heavily seasoned or smoked options so the clean flavors of the salad shine through.

Can I make Classic Chicken Salad without mayonnaise?

Absolutely! Try swapping in Greek yogurt or a combination of yogurt and sour cream for a lighter version. You might also like a touch of olive oil whisked with lemon juice for a fresh, dairy-free alternative.

How long does Classic Chicken Salad last in the fridge?

Properly stored, Classic Chicken Salad keeps well for about 3 days in the refrigerator. Always check for freshness before serving—look for off smells or a watery consistency as signs it’s time to say goodbye.

What can I add for extra flavor?

Feel free to stir in extras like halved grapes, diced apples, toasted nuts, or dried cranberries if you like a little sweetness or crunch. A pinch of smoked paprika or a splash of hot sauce can offer a little zip, too.

Is Classic Chicken Salad gluten-free?

Yes, the salad itself is naturally gluten-free. Just be mindful of what you serve it with—skip the bread or crackers if you’re serving someone with gluten sensitivities and choose lettuce wraps or gluten-free options instead.

Classic Chicken Salad Recipe

This Classic Chicken Salad recipe is a timeless favorite that’s easy to make and delicious to eat. Packed with tender chicken, crunchy celery, and flavorful seasonings, it’s perfect for sandwiches, wraps, or enjoying on its own.

  • Author: Maya
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x
  • Category: Salad
  • Method: Mixing
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Ingredients

Scale

For the Salad:

  • 4 cups cooked chicken (shredded or diced)
  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• ½ cup diced celery (¼” dice)
  • ⅓ cup diced red onion (or shallots, dice)
  • 2 tablespoons sliced green onions (or chives)
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 2 teaspoons lemon juice
  • ½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  1. Make the Salad – In a large bowl, combine the chicken, mayonnaise, celery, red onion, green onions, mustard,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ix well until evenly combined.
  2. To Serve – Adjust seasoning with more salt and pepper if needed. Enjoy immediately or chill in the refrigerator until ready to serve.
